Some interesting carrier offers for Samsung’s new foldable devices


TL;DR

  • Samsung unveiled the new Galaxy Z Fold 8, Z Fold 8 Ultra and Galaxy Flip 8 at an event in London.
  • While AT&T, Verizon and T-Mobile have opened pre-orders for the phones, in-store availability will begin on August 7.
  • In addition to the Galaxy Watch 9 and Galaxy Watch Ultra 2, all carriers are offering significant discounts on new foldable devices.

Big Red offers 256GB Galaxy Z Fold 8 $30 per month for 48 months, subject to carrier registration the new Simplicity Planthough Verizon says you don’t need to trade in another device.

On the other hand, it will offer to add a new line or upgrade to the Simplicity Plan Galaxy Z Fold 8 Ultra For $35 per month for 48 months, $420 off the $2,100 foldable price tag.

Separately, trading in an eligible device on the carrier’s Unlimited Plus or Unlimited Ultimate plans will entitle customers to a $1,100 discount on the Galaxy Z Fold 8 or its Ultra sibling.

Customers can also get the Galaxy Watch 9 and Galaxy Tab S10 FE at no cost when they buy a new Samsung device or bring their own device to Verizon. Similarly, getting a new Verizon line on your Android phone will qualify you for a free Galaxy Watch 9 or the more powerful Galaxy Watch 8 Ultra for $8 a month.

To sweeten the deal even more, Verizon is giving away six months of Disney+, Hulu and ESPN+ (with ads) to eligible Galaxy Z Fold 8 and Z Fold 8 Ultra buyers on its network.

Giving Verizon a good run for its launch money, T-Mobile offers Galaxy Z Fold 8 and his Ultra Get $1,900 off via invoice credit when you trade in an eligible device on Experience Beyond and Go5G Next plans. That means the Z Fold 8 can be yours for nothing, and the Z Fold 8 Ultra will set you back just $200.

Likewise, Galaxy Z Flip 8 Experience More, Experience Beyond, and Go5G Plus or Go5G Next plans can be yours for just $100, $1,100 off when you add a new line or trade in a device.

As for the new wearables, T-Mobile will offer Galaxy Watch Ultra 2 270 dollars or Galaxy Watch 9 free as part of Watch Plan Plus in the form of monthly payment credits for two years. The carrier said it will offer a 25% discount on a bundle that includes a screen protector, case and an unspecified version of the Samsung Buds. But this pack will be available only on July 30.
